- Inhalt
- Optical methods have an overriding importance in obtaining and transmitting information. The lecture will convey essential physical and technical principals as well as practical methods, tips and tricks for the work of a physicist or engineer in the lab. If desired, exercises can also be performed at the available optical 3D sensors.
1. Illumination: Lighting parameters, physiological aspects, photography, photo receiver, noise. How bright is an image? How does a projector work? How can we see stars at daylight?
2. Imaging I: Geometric imaging in the Gauss range, optical instruments, telecentrics, Scheimpflug condition, accommodation and acuity. How to solve imaging tasks in the lab?
3. Imaging II: Geometric imaging with aberrations, 3rd order aberrations. How to accomplish imaging tasks almost free of errors with “toolkit” optics?
4. Imaging III: Technical wave optics, tolerance criteria for image quality, transfer function, point image, resolution, depth of field. When is an image “sharp”? Where are the physical and technical limits of the imaging?
5. Optical Measuring: Sensors for measuring geometric and optical parameters, optical 3D sensors. How to measure an angle, focusing, length, distance, refractive index, Schlieren?
